Barcelona: Barcelona have been crowned back-to-back Spanish champions under Hansi Flick after defeating Real Madrid 2-0 in El Clásico, securing a 14-point lead at the top with just three games remaining, APA reports.
According to Azeri-Press News Agency, two early goals from Marcus Rashford and Ferran Torres were sufficient for Barcelona on a day when Flick was on the sidelines despite the announcement of his father’s death shortly before kickoff.
The victory marked only the second instance in LaLiga history where the outcome of El Clásico directly resulted in one of the teams winning the league title. The previous occasion was in 1932 when a 2-2 draw between the teams allowed Madrid to clinch the title.
